  • Abstract
    In this paper different excitations of a silver nano dipole in free space are considered. The excitation varieties include a plane wave, and an imposed current with different tuning circuits. The response of the dipole demonstrates a clear resonance response for all excitations. The use of the tuning circuit permits to correct slightly the position of the resonance if necessary. The tuning circuits considered are inspired by the RF domain. They include feeding lines with various widths and different T-match connections. The analysis is performed using a full wave solver based on the method of moments.
